According to FAU Police, three Hispanic males with a handgun robbed a student living on the second floor of UVA last night. Much like the alleged carjacking, this wasn't random but a targeted attack. Apparently they're interviewing a suspect.

Which was a good design idea for IVA, absolutely.

In this case though it was the UVA dorm though, not IVA, and there are doors on both sides of the midsection that require an Owl card - or - a friendly resident to get you through those doors. I had friends who lived there and I never had an issue getting in and out of there.

In the case of UVA, FAU could consider sealing up those midsection doors and requiring everyone go through the lobby at the south end, which means they'd get vetted by an RA. It'd be an inconvenience for the students but in theory it'd cut down on crime.
